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

An isocyanate reactive composition for making a polyurethane foam includes a tertiary amine urethane catalyst comprising a di(C1-C4)alkyl fatty alkyl amine and a polyester polyol. The use of one or more of fatty alkyl tertiary amine serves to reduce hydrolysis of the polyester polyol in the isocyanate reactive composition.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

The invention claimed is: 1. A method of making a polyurethane spray rigid foam, the method comprising combining a polyisocyanate and an isocyanate reactive composition comprising a polyester polyol, water and a urethane catalyst composition comprising 10 to 40 wt % pentamethyldiethylenetriamine, 20 to 80 wt % tris(dimethylaminopropyl) amine and 10 to 50 wt % dimethylhexadecyl amine. 2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the isocyanate reactive composition further comprises a fire retardant. 3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the isocyanate reactive composition further comprises a Mannich polyol. 4. The method of claim 3 , wherein the urethane catalyst composition comprises at least one other tertiary amine urethane catalyst. 5. The method of claim 3 , wherein the isocyanate reactive composition further comprises one or more blowing agents. 6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the isocyanate reactive composition further comprises at least one member selected from the group consisting of cell stabilizers, crosslinking agents, chain extenders, pigments, and fillers. 7. The method of claim 6 , wherein the chain extenders comprise at least one of ethylene glycol and 1,4-butanediol.
